Erin Hoffman

She has published three fantasy novels, and been the lead designer on multiple games such as Kung Fu Panda World, GoPets: Vacation Island, and Frontierville.

Her anonymous post as a disgruntled "EA Spouse" in 2004, based on the working conditions of her husband who was an Electronic Arts developer, led to industry-wide awareness of the frequent use of "crunch time" overtime work to complete games in the video game industry.

[1] In 2010, she was appointed to the board of directors of the International Game Developers Association,[2] a position which she held until early 2011.

[1] The post, made on November 11, 2004 to LiveJournal, sharply criticized the labor practices of Electronic Arts.

[9] After the affair and the court action, Hoffman and Hasty founded GameWatch, a watchdog organization meant to facilitate discussions between employees at different companies.
